K372 OTC is a 1993 BMW 316 in Green with a 1,596c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 65%.

Across all 1993 BMW 316 models, the average MOT pass rate is 63.3% with a typical mileage of 116,811 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a BMW 316 f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 71,150 recorded failures. If you're considering buying K372 OTC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W 316 typ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 33 years old, this BMW 316 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
